James "Jim" Thomas Frediani, 93, of Geneva, Illinois, formerly of Huntley, passed away peacefully on July 19, 2025.
He was born on June 20, 1932 in Chicago, Illinois to Daniel and Angeline (Simon) Frediani. Jim served in the U.S. Army from 1953 to 1956, mostly in Okinawa. He married the love of his life, Joanne Jordan, on October 1, 1966 in Chicago, Illinois. She survives.
Jim worked as a cost analyst in the insurance business for much of his career, but also enjoyed working as a school bus driver for nearly two decades. The couple called Palatine home for 33 years before making their move to the Huntley area. He was a lifelong 16-inch softball player and played in several leagues in the Chicago area until his 60's. Jim was a devout Catholic and a parishioner of St. Peter Church in Geneva at the time of his passing. When he wasn't cheering on his beloved Chicago Cubs, he enjoyed spending time hiking and camping. He passed his love of nature down to his children and grandchildren. He was a beloved husband, father, grandfather, and great-grandfather. He will be deeply missed.
In addition to his wife, Joanne, Jim is survived by his sons, James (Michelle) Frediani, Michael (Eva) Frediani, and Thomas Frediani; his grandchildren, Kayla, Anthony, Daniel, Thala, Hannah, Amanda, Rachel, Michael, and Jessica; and his great-grandchildren, Kaden, Nicholas, Madilynn, Jailee, Noelle, and River.
Jim was preceded in death by his parents and his siblings.
